On roll call the following vote was recorded: <br /> <br />I <br /> <br />AYE: <br /> <br />Diaz, Guerrero, Narvaiz and Taylor. <br /> <br />NAY: Mihalkanin, Thomaides and Bose. <br /> <br />ABSTAIN: None. <br /> <br />Mayor Narvaiz introduced for consideration a public hearing and adoption <br />of a Zoning Ordinance, the caption which was read as follows: <br /> <br />I <br /> <br />A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F SAN MARCOS, TEXAS, <br />AMENDING THE OFFICIAL ZONING MAP OF THE CITY BY ASSIGNING INITIAL <br />ZONING OF "ZL" ZERO LOT LINE DWELLING DISTRICT (LOW DENSITY) FOR <br />SEVEN TRACTS OF LAND TOTALING 231.485 ACRES, "P" PUBLIC AND <br />INSTITUTIONAL DISTRICT FOR FIVE TRACTS OF LAND TOTALING 37.905 <br />ACRES, "LB" LIMITED BUSINESS DISTRICT ON TWO TRACTS OF LAND <br />TOTALING 7.010 ACRES, AND "R-1" SINGLE-FAMILY DWELLING DISTRICT <br />(LOW DENSITY) ON SIX TRACTS OF LAND TOTALING 194.37 ACRES, ALL <br />LOCATED WITHIN THE PROPOSED BLANCO VISTA SUBDIVISION NEAR THE <br />INTERSECTION OF POST ROAD AND OLD STAGECOACH ROAD; INCLUDING <br />PROCEDURAL PROVISIONS; AND PROVIDING FOR PENALTIES. <br /> <br />Mayor Narvaiz opened the public hearing and asked if anyone wished to <br />speak. 1) Bill Hale encouraged the Council to approve this zoning <br />amendment. Mayor Narvaiz asked if anyone else wished to speak. No one <br />did, so Mayor Narvaiz closed the public hearing. Mr. Bose inquired as to <br />the Zero Lot Line zoning. Carol Barrett, Director of Planning and <br />Development, stated the Zero Lot Line zoning is a Low Density zoning <br />designation, which allows up to six units to be built per acre. She <br />stated these are Single-Family homes similar to patio homes. Mr. Bose <br />inquired whether a section of this property located on the new Old <br />Stagecoach Road is in the City or County. Ms. Barrett stated the new <br />section of Old Stagecoach Road is in the County. She also stated the <br />developers will be paying a fee in lieu of parkland dedication. Mr. <br />Bose inquired to the 50' easement and the 200' buffer located on the <br />map. Ms. Barrett stated this is a gas line easement, which will remain <br />undeveloped open space. The Council voted unanimously for adoption of <br />the Zoning Ordinance. <br /> <br />Mayor Narvaiz introduced for consideration approval of an Ordinance on <br />second reading, the caption which was read as follows: <br /> <br />I <br /> <br />A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F SAN MARCOS, TEXAS, <br />ADOPTING A NEW CITY OF SAN MARCOS LAND DEVELOPMENT CODE, INCLUDING <br />CHAPTER 1, DEVELOPMENT PROCEDURES, CHAPTER 2, DEVELOPMENT IN THE <br />EXTRATERRITORIAL JURISDICTION, CHAPTER 3, COMPREHENSIVE PLANNING, <br />
